People always have to visit their hometowns. So I came to Jiangyou, my ancestral home. This is a seriously underestimated small town. The tranquil and poetic atmosphere makes people feel comfortable. Li Bai lived here for 24 years. I spent one day to experience his world. 🍵Must-check-in • Chanlin Temple. A temple hidden deep in the fields. The temple is not big, but there is a different world inside. You can copy scriptures and pray, drink tea and enjoy flowers, and you can also see the 🚂 small train passing through the fields. It is simply an ideal back garden.
You can also explore the nearby country roads, where there are abandoned railways and rice fields, which are great for taking photos!
☑Reservation for balcony seats is required in advance on holidays
☑The temple has vegetarian meals🍚Lunch at 11:30, dinner at 17:30
☑If you drive, there is a parking lot here; if you come by train, it takes 10 minutes to get there by taxi from Jiangyou Station
🎋Must-check-in•Li Bai Memorial Hall
In the autumn of October, the Li Bai Memorial Hall is still green and lush, 🎐Cicadas chirping, light falling, ancient wood fragrance... Although it is an imitation Tang Dynasty building, the simple beauty of the garden landscape is enough to make me stop.
The memorial hall not only houses several collections of Li Bai's poems, but also calligraphy and paintings by famous artists of all dynasties. If you have enough time, it is really worth staying here.
☑Tickets are free, opening hours are 9:00-17:00
☑There is a 🍵Gu Mo Ningjia Teahouse on the right hand side of the entrance of the scenic spot, which is good, with an average of 10-40 yuan per person
☑Stamps can be stamped in the cultural and creative store at the entrance. Friends who like to collect stamps should remember to bring a notebook
🚄Transportation: From Chengdu, it takes 1 hour to reach Jiangyou by high-speed rail, and 3 hours to reach Jiangyou by self-driving
📝Recommended one-day route: Jiangyou Station-Chanlin Temple-Li Bai Memorial Hall-Pao Cannon Street-Jiangyou Station
🥘Must-check-in food: Jiangyou pig intestines, Mianyang rice noodles
⛰️If you have time, you can also climb Doushan Mountain, which is a fairy mountain written into poems by Li Bai
